Shipment planning platform: APL Logistics has rolled out a new shipment planning
platform that automatically generates the best shipment plan against three key objectives: 1) making sure cargo arrives at the final destination on the preferred date, 2)
maximizing space and load utilization, and 3) minimizing overall transportation costs.
Called ShipmentOptimizer, this planning platform integrates a Web-based shipment planning and optimization tool with APL Logistics’ supply chain expertise and
technology applications. It first considers all possible combinations of shipment
flows, modes, routes, and cargoes and then recommends the ideal shipment plan.
(APL Logistics, www.apllogistics.com/shipmentoptimizer)
Asset-tracking service: Hutchison Port
Holdings (HPH) has unveiled StellarTrak, a
Web-based on-demand service that provides
HPH’s LoadStar customers with cargo-security,
monitoring, and asset-tracking services.
StellarTrak gives LoadStar customers real-time information about their cargo and
assets. It tells customers the precise location
of their cargo and assets as well as the security and environmental status of the products
inside. Customers can also subscribe to
LoadStar’s monitoring service. (Hutchison Port
Holdings, www.LoadStarGlobal.com)
Handheld bar-code
scanner: Denso ADC’s
new AT20B handheld
bar-code scanner features
high-speed scanning, user-friendly operation, and high
durability. The company’s
Advanced Scan Plus technology gives the AT20B twice
the scanning speed of previous models.
Using the latest Denso algorithms, the
AT20B can scan poorly printed or otherwise
difficult-to-read bar codes. The device also
allows trouble-free scanning of wide bar
codes. The AT20B’s compact, lightweight,
and ergonomic shape makes it easy to hold
and aim, reducing operator fatigue. An LED
guidelight makes it easier for users to aim the
scanner, even when they’re scanning multi-level or very small bar codes.
Denso designed the AT20B to be durable. It
features IP42 dust- and water-resistant protection as well as a connector-cable locking
mechanism that prevents damage to the connector or cable. Other features of the AT20B
include easy-to-use configuration software
and an auto-sense scanning mode. A data-verification function allows verification to be
done with a single scanner, while data-editing
functions allow simple programming (ADF
scripting) for data truncating, sorting, and
converting. A command-control function
enables the scanner to be controlled by a PC
for fully automated operation. (Denso ADC,
www.denso-adc.com)
SwingMast lift truck: The four-wheel Drexel
SwingMast lift truck models SL30, SL40, and
SL50 from Landoll Corp. have been converted
to 100-percent AC technology. Other
improvements include a new swivel seat, single joystick control, and a larger side-load
bed. These improvements increase run time
on a shift and increase operator comfort and
productivity, the company says. (Landoll
Corp., www.landoll.com)
